Thermal Camera Payloads

The potential uses for thermal cameras on drones are nearly limitless. Originally developed for surveillance and military operations, thermal cameras are now widely used for building inspections (moisture, insulation, roofing, etc.), firefighting, industrial inspections, scientific research, and much more.

Wiris Pro

The Workswell WIRIS Pro is a fully radiometric thermal camera that has been specially designed for use with drones. The WIRIS Pro is built for the most demanding applications, including industrial inspections, archaeology, and precision agriculture.
